IUPAC Alkane Naming

Naming an alkane means identifying its longest continuous carbon chain for the base name, numbering that chain from the end nearest any substituent, and listing substituents alphabetically with position numbers chosen to keep those numbers as low as possible; when two numbering directions give the same lowest locant set, the direction assigning the lower number to whichever substituent is cited first alphabetically is chosen instead.
A four-carbon chain with a bromine on the second carbon from one end and a chlorine on the first is named by numbering from the chlorine end, giving 2-bromo-1-chlorobutane rather than the higher alternative. For a seven-carbon chain carrying a bromo substituent and a methyl substituent positioned so each numbering direction gives the identical locant set {2,6}, the tie is broken by assigning the lower number to whichever substituent is cited first alphabetically — bromo before methyl — yielding 2-bromo-6-methylheptane rather than 6-bromo-2-methylheptane.
Numbering from whichever end is drawn first, rather than checking which direction gives the lowest substituent numbers, produces a technically wrong name even when every substituent is correctly identified. Likewise, breaking a genuine locant-set tie by chain-drawing order instead of alphabetical priority assigns the wrong low number to the wrong substituent, even though both substituents and both locants are individually correct.
